A member on another CAP discussion list made a very good point today -- Shouldn't CAP be leading the way in upgrading the ELTs in our fleet from 121.5 to 406?
I think they probably plan to phase them in along with the new aircraft...
We're not getting that many new aircraft quickly enough for that to make a big impact on the overall fleet.
the transition from 121.5 to 406 ELTs in CAP aircraft has been underway for about two years, that I know of. The 206 in the Sq that I just left had a 406 installed over a year ago. It isn't a new aircraft, 1972, in fact. I believe that most of the CAWG aircraft(26) have the new ELTs installed.
Pretty pricey: installation alone runs $1800. I can't remember what the unit costs.
